6-Week Musical Theatre Fall Intensive (Grades 9-12)
Take the next step in your artistic journey with Asolo Rep’s Musical Theatre Fall Intensive, a 6-week training program for passionate high school actors. This series is perfect for students preparing for college auditions or simply looking to sharpen their skills during the school year.
Guided by Asolo Rep’s professional artists and special guest industry experts, students will explore:
- Audition Technique – Learn how to present yourself confidently in both acting and musical theatre auditions.
- Monologue & Song Coaching – Receive personalized feedback to help you shine.
- Movement – Strengthen your stage presence and physical storytelling.
- Mock Audition & Feedback Session – Apply your new skills in a supportive environment.
Whether you dream of Broadway, college theatre programs, or simply want to level up your skills, this intensive offers conservatory-style training in a collaborative, creative space.
*This intensive is designed for students with prior acting or musical theatre experience and is not intended for beginners.
